In 2020-2021, 4,322 people earned their degree in baking and pastry arts/baker/pastry chef, making the major the 367th most popular in the United States.
Across Arkansas, there were 73 baking and pastry arts/baker/pastry chef gra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ively.
The colleges and universities that top this list are recognized because their baking and pastry arts/baker/pastry chef program is one of the largest majors offered at the school.
